CSX2223 was purchased new by Dr. Joseph Barkey on 2/19/1964 from none other than Ed Hugus’ Continental Cars dealership. As many of you know Hugus was a good friend and business associate of Carroll Shelby, and Hugus’ dealership actually completed the first few Cobras built, not Shelby American!

Delivered new exactly as you see it here in red/black, with all of the Class A accessories and even a few neat “competition” options such as front and rear sway bars and side exiting exhaust.

Dr. Barkey was the track medic for Mid Ohio and used CSX2223 in his duties there. It was his prized possession. When he could no longer drive he insisted on retaining CSX2223, placing it in storage in his garage- the same garage that CSX2223 had called home since new. Dr. Barkey passed away in 2009, and in early 2011 I purchased the car from Dr. Barkey’s son.

Since the car had been dormant for a number of years my shop carefully and thoroughly recommissioned every mechanical system on CSX2223 from the engine to the suspension, all without doing anything more cosmetically than cleaning everything and preserving all of the original finishes. The fuel system, all hydraulics, all suspension bushings and pins, differential, transmission, cooling system, and more were all comprehensively serviced. Today the car simply runs and drives as new.

Unlike most Cobras CSX2223 retains every original part, component, and fastener it left Shelby American with, including its original engine, transmission, cast iron intake and Autolite carburetor, cast “Y” headers and original hardware, its original engine break-in fan, original wheels, original leather seats, and even all of its top, side curtains and tonneau cover. Dr. Barkey had CSX2223 repainted once many, many years ago and it has now mellowed to a patina consistent with this incredibly original car complete with road rash and other scars of use.

The paperwork and documentation for CSX2223 is second to none, from the original purchase contract to its original owners manual and even the original Cobra warranty paperwork, a document even I had never seen before! CSX2223 even retains her original keys, Cobra key fob, and dealership inventory key tag from Continental Cars.

CSX2223 has been shown once, at the 2014 SAAC National Convention at Elkhart Lake, Wisconsin. It won a SAAC Survivor and Chairman’s Choice award.
